Export, Agglomeration And Industrial Efficiency

Industrial efficiency is an old topic which is often studied in economics and as the development of the society, new factors ceaselessly spring up. Accordingly, many researchers think more deeply and thoroughly about how to boost industrial efficiency. From1990s, more and more scholars come to pay much attention to the impact coming from industrial agglomeration. The theoretical and empirical studies about this become more and more and all those studies can be divided into two categories. The first is theoretical analysis about how industrial agglomeration improves industrial efficiency and the second is empirical study with the help of statistics. Although the theoretical analysis always emphasizes that industrial agglomeration can boost mdustrial efficiency by spillover of knowledge and techniques, large-scale market, sharing human resources and infrastructures, connections among different industries and so forth, many empirical studies differs in this:some are in favor of it bur the other are against it. Although there are not many empirical studies analyzing specifically those restraining factors, it reveals that industrial agglomeration does not always promote industrial efficiency and maybe there are other factors that restrict their impacts on industrial efficiency. From this perspective, I will study thoroughly how export influences agglomeration’s boosting effect on industrial efficiency in China. In theory, this paper has studied a lot of relative documents and at the same time analyzed theoretically how export impacts industrial agglomeration in Chinese manufacturing business.Export can boost as well as restrain industrial agglomeration, and moreover, it may be very unusual when it restricts industrial agglomeration. Sometimes, it maybe damages the good effect coming from agglomeration to mdustrial efficiency.In empirical study, considering data availability and integrity, I choose to make use of data coming from20trades of manufacturing businesses from2001to2011in China and process these data by analysis of regression. As a result, I find the manufacturing industry has been gathering into eastern coastal provinces because of the opening-up policy carried out over30years ago and the convenient exporting circumstances. Export damaged this kind of agglomeration’s good effect on industrial efficiency.Finally, the thesis analyze this conclusion and put forward relative suggestions.
